Abstract

The material flow in the cross-section of a kiln is important to the transport mechanisms such as particulate mixing and energy transport within the bed of material. This chapter describes some case studies carried out with the objective of understanding and to improving the predictive capabilities of the rheological behavior of granular materials in rotary cylinders needed for the efficient operation and quality control of the product.
